About the role

A Day in the Life of the Director, Construction:
  • Manage the design and construction of all activities in support of plant constructions, rebuilds and existing plant upgrades.
  • Work closely with the leadership team to develop annual and project budgets, allocating appropriate funds for new builds, rebuilds, upgrades and other construction efforts.
  • Provide management support for Design, Construction, Fiber Construction, Planned and Emergency Restoration, Utility Relations and Project Management.
  • Manage financial resources to ensure compliance with budget allocations and forecasts
  • Provide subject matter guidance to employees.
  • Oversee the development and the administration of performance standards for the organizational unit.
  • Manage a team which may include exempt and non-exempt employees, providing development, training and promotion opportunities where applicable
  • Develop processes and procedures to drive department efficiencies, assist in development and meeting of departmental budget.
  • Schedule construction projects; oversee compliance of safety standards and quality control of construction projects.
  • Initiate and monitor processes for expenditures while ensuring budget compliance.
  • Verify applicable construction codes and safety regulations are being applied and upheld.
  • Maintain a high level of productivity; assuring time frames are met for projects occurring simultaneously.
  • Track and generate reports on project status.
  • Track and trend expenditures and approve invoices within budgetary guidelines.
  • Manage inventory requirements for construction projects.
  • Authorize company expenditures related to construction activities.
  • Manage all projects to meet or exceed minimum specification to Company Construction Policy, FCC Technical Standards, NEC, OSHA, State, County and/or City and all other applicable agencies.
  • Maintain the invoice verification program for all contractor projects.
  • Works with Marketing and Commercial Development teams to ensure budgeted subscribers are built, activated and/or upgraded as planned.
  • Demonstrate a consistent exercise of independent judgment and discretion
  • Supervise and evaluate construction personnel; coordinate construction efforts through in-house and contract labor for new construction and rebuild projects both aerial and underground.
  • Represent the interests of Astound in a professional manner with governmental, municipal, and related industry organizations.
  • Create and maintain accurate project documentation and reporting through departments data management programs in a timely and efficient manner.
  • Coordinate and work with utility companies, developers and engineers.
  • Monitor contractor performance; ensure adherence to terms and conditions of agreements and ensure all personnel and contractors are adhering to local and state construction requirements and codes.
  • Perform site inspections for quality control and safety.
  • Coordinate permitting and make-ready process.
  • Manage communications with internal/external groups.
  • Communicate with Project Manager or designated supervisor regarding concerns about construction progress.
  • Review and process damage claims.
  • Work closely with staff in developing capital projects and purchase requests for the construction team.
  • Other duties as assigned

What You Bring to the Table:

  • Education: High school diploma or equivalent
  • Prior experience as OSP Design Engineer or 10+ years OSP experience in communications

    construction and maintenance, or an equivalent combination of education and experience.

  • Minimum of 3 years of successful leadership experience, supervising in-house and contract

    labor resources.

  • Advanced understanding of access networks on various fiber architectures.

  • Experience with fiber to the home (FTTH) and HFC network design and construction methods

  • Solid knowledge in OSP construction methods and practices

  • Proven understanding of Microsoft Office Suite

  • Strong interpersonal and customer services skills

  • Proven leadership skills

  • Vision ability; close vision, peripheral vision and ability to adjust focus.

  • Travel will be required across CA, OR, and WA as need
